Dedicated Server & Virtual Private Server

Dedicated Server vs Virtual Private Server

Dedicated servers and virtual private servers (VPS) are two different hosting options with distinct advantages and use cases. Here’s a comparison of both:

Dedicated Server:

  1. Isolation: A dedicated server is an entire physical machine dedicated to a single user or organization. It provides complete isolation from other users or virtual environments.

  2. Resources: You have exclusive access to all the server’s hardware resources, including CPU, RAM, storage, and bandwidth. This makes it highly reliable and capable of handling resource-intensive tasks.

  3. Customization: You have full control over the server’s configuration, including the choice of operating system, software, and hardware components.

  4. Performance: Dedicated servers offer the highest level of performance and reliability. They are ideal for applications that require consistent high performance, such as large websites, databases, and resource-intensive applications.

  5. Scalability: While you can upgrade the hardware of a dedicated server, it may require downtime or migration to a new physical server, making scalability less flexible compared to VPS.

  6. Cost: Dedicated servers are generally more expensive than VPS hosting due to the exclusive access to hardware resources.

  7. Management: Typically, you have the option to manage the server yourself (unmanaged) or opt for a managed dedicated server where the hosting provider handles server maintenance, security, and updates.

 
 

Virtual Private Server (VPS):

  1. Isolation: VPS hosting involves dividing a physical server into multiple virtual servers, each with its dedicated resources and operating system. While there’s some level of isolation, it’s not as strong as with a dedicated server.

  2. Resources: VPS hosting provides dedicated resources within the allocated virtual environment, but these resources are shared among multiple users. This means that resource availability can be impacted if other VPS on the same physical server consume excessive resources.

  3. Customization: You have more flexibility than shared hosting but less than a dedicated server. You can usually choose your OS and configure some aspects of the server.

  4. Performance: VPS performance can vary depending on the hosting provider, the number of VPS on the same physical server, and the resource allocation. It’s suitable for small to medium-sized websites and applications.

  5. Scalability: VPS hosting is more scalable than shared hosting but less flexible than dedicated servers. You can easily upgrade your resources, often with minimal downtime.

  6. Cost: VPS hosting is generally more affordable than dedicated servers, making it a cost-effective choice for many businesses and individuals.

  7. Management: You can choose between managed and unmanaged VPS hosting, depending on whether you want the hosting provider to handle server management tasks.

The choice between a dedicated server and a VPS depends on your specific needs, budget, and technical expertise. If you require maximum performance, complete control, and have a larger budget, a dedicated server may be the better choice. On the other hand, if you’re looking for a balance between performance and cost-efficiency, a VPS can be a suitable option.